调频式气体分子速率分布律实验仪

Frequency modulated experimental instrument of velocity distribution law of gas molecular

摘要 伽尔顿板实验仪是直接或间接验证麦克斯韦气体分子速率分布律、气体的能均分定理、气体压强的产生、气体温度产生的重要仪器.旧式的伽尔顿板实验仪由于受到动力学效应的约束,显示出明显的局限性.通过对原有仪器进行改进,使每行钉子在水平方向往返运动,增加了钉子与小球的碰撞概率,实验结果更接近统计规律. Galton board instrument is important because it can verify Maxwell velocity distribution law and the principle of equipartition~ it can explain the principle of gas pressure and temperature. Be- cause of the constraint of kinetic effects, Galton board experiment instrument shows obvious limita- tions. This paper improved the structure of instrument, and each line nails reciprocally vibrated in the horizontal direction. The collision probability between nails and ball was added and the experiment re- sult more approched with the statistical law.
